In This Role
As an Android Test Automation Engineer with our client, you will help ensure the quality, reliability, and stability of next-generation Android-based devices by developing and maintaining automated testing solutions. You will work closely with software engineers and quality teams to build automation that provisions, configures, and validates software on physical prototype devices throughout the development lifecycle. This position requires strong software engineering skills, hands-on experience with Android test automation, and the ability to independently troubleshoot issues while contributing to continuous improvements in test coverage, automation, and release quality.
Responsibilities
Design, develop, maintain, and enhance automated test suites for Android applications and platform components.
Create automation that provisions, configures, deploys, and validates software on physical Android prototype devices.
Maintain and operate a physical Android device lab, including device provisioning, software updates, connectivity, inventory management, and test readiness.
Collaborate with software engineers and quality teams to integrate automated tests into existing CI/CD pipelines and automation frameworks.
Investigate automated test failures, identify root causes, and improve test reliability and stability.
Analyze software changes to identify testing gaps and prioritize regression coverage for high-risk functionality.
Reproduce software defects, collect and analyze logs, crash reports, and telemetry data to support debugging and issue resolution.
Validate software fixes and support release readiness through comprehensive testing and quality verification.
Document test plans, automation processes, test procedures, and quality results.
Provide regular status updates, communicate technical risks, and recommend improvements to testing strategies and automation.
Required Qualifications
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Software Engineering, or a related technical field, or equivalent practical experience.
5+ years of software engineering or software development in test (SDET) experience.
1+ years of experience developing automated tests for Android applications or Android-based devices.
Experience provisioning, configuring, and executing software on physical Android devices.
Strong programming experience in Kotlin, C++, or another strongly typed programming language.
Experience designing, implementing, and maintaining automated test frameworks.
Experience debugging software issues and analyzing test failures using logs, crash reports, and diagnostic tools.
Experience working with CI/CD pipelines and automated build validation.
Ability to work independently, manage technical priorities, and deliver high-quality solutions.
Strong communication and cross-functional collaboration skills.
Preferred Qualifications
Experience working with Android Open Source Project (AOSP) or customized Android platforms.
Experience validating software on prototype or pre-production hardware.
Experience with device provisioning, firmware validation, or embedded/mobile device testing.
Knowledge of Android application lifecycle, system architecture, and debugging tools.
Experience building or maintaining automated testing infrastructure for physical device labs.
Familiarity with release validation processes and regression testing strategies.
Experience analyzing telemetry, performance metrics, and crash diagnostics to improve software quality.
Experience collaborating in Agile software development environments.
Passion for automation, continuous improvement, and delivering high-quality software on emerging hardware platforms.
